About the Role

We are the world's largest university press that serves the academic community by partnering with institutions and learned societies to bring knowledge to students and researchers worldwide. Our mission is impact, and we re-invest in our people, publishing, and the research community. The UK corporate sales team based in Oxford helps connect clients with advertising and publishing solutions, focusing on digital products in a fast-paced, collaborative environment. The role involves selling digital advertising for prestigious medical journals, building relationships with advertising agencies and healthcare companies, and developing expertise in healthcare advertising.
